Q: Is 204,128 a Prime Number?
A: No, 204,128 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 204128 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 32 6,379 12,758 25,516 51,032 102,064 and 204,128, with no remainder.
Since 204,128 cannot be divided by just 1 and 204,128, it is not a prime number.
